急性脑梗死患者血清水通道蛋白4及水通道蛋白9的表达与脑损伤严重程度的相关性OACSTPCD
Correlation between the expression of serum aquaporin 4 and aquaporin 9 and severity of brain injury in patients with acute cerebral infarction
目的 探讨急性脑梗死患者血清水通道蛋白4(AQP4)、水通道蛋白 9(AQP9)的表达与脑损伤严重程度的相关性.方法 选取 2018 年 6 月至 2020 年 8 月开滦总医院收治的 60 例急性脑梗死患者为急性脑梗死组,另选取同期进行体检的健康人群 58 例为对照组.根据美国国立卫生研究院卒中量表(NIHSS),将急性脑梗死患者分为轻度缺损组、中度缺损组、重度缺损组.采用酶联免疫吸附法检测急性脑梗死患者血清中AQP4、AQP9 水平.采用Spearman相关性分析患者血清中AQP4、AQP9 与NIHSS评分的相关性;采用多因素Logistic回归分析影响急性脑梗死发生的危险因素.结果 急性脑梗死组睡眠呼吸暂停综合征比例、血尿酸、抗心磷脂抗体、总胆固醇(TC)、低密度脂蛋白胆固醇(LDL-C)、超敏C反应蛋白(hs-CRP)、脑钠肽(BNP)、同型半胱氨酸(Hcy)均高于对照组(t/χ2=17.596、15.877、21.866、30.226、18.991、39.505、17.287、12.003,P<0.05).与对照组相比,急性脑梗死组患者血清中AQP4、AQP9 水平上升(t=29.573、20.152,P<0.05).Spearman相关性分析结果表明,急性脑梗死患者血清中AQP4、AQP9 表达与NIHSS评分呈正相关(r=0.488、0.609,P<0.05).与轻度缺损组相比,中度缺损组患者血清AQP4、AQP9 水平升高;与中度缺损组相比,重度缺损组患者血清AQP4、AQP9 水平升高(F=34.454、44.728,P<0.05);多因素Logistic回归分析显示,血尿酸、抗心磷脂抗体、hs-CRP、BNP、Hcy、AQP4、AQP9是急性脑梗死的危险因素(OR=1.748、1.894、1.928、3.164、2.593、2.163、1.975,P<0.05).结论 急性脑梗死患者血清中AQP4、AQP9 表达水平升高,与脑损伤严重程度密切相关.
Objective To investigate the correlation between the expression of serum aquaporin 4(AQP4),serum aquaporin 9(AQP9)and the severity of brain injury in patients with acute cerebral infarction.Methods From June 2018 to August 2020,60 patients with acute cerebral infarction admitted to Kailuan General Hospital were selected as the acute cerebral infarction group,and 58 healthy individuals who underwent physical examinations during the same period were selected as the control group.According to the National Institutes of Health Stroke Scale(NIHSS),patients with acute cerebral infarction were divided into mild,moderate and severe deficit groups.Enzyme-linked immunosorbent assay was applied to detect serum AQP4 and AQP9 levels in patients with acute cerebral infarction.Spearman correlation was applied to analyze the correlations between serum AQP4,AQP9,and NIHSS score of patients.Multivariate Logistic regression was applied to analyze the risk factors for acute cerebral infarction.Results The proportion of sleep apnea syndrome,blood uric acid,anticardiolipin antibodies,total cholesterol(TC),low-density lipoprotein cholesterol(LDL-C),high sensitivity C-reactive protein(hs-CRP),brain natriuretic peptide(BNP),and homocysteine(Hcy)in the acute cerebral infarction group were higher than those in the control group(t/χ2=17.596,15.877,21.866,30.226,18.991,39.505,17.287,12.003;P<0.05).Compared with the control group,the levels of serum AQP4 and AQP9 in the acute cerebral infarction group were increased(t=29.573,20.152;P<0.05).Spearman correlation analysis showed that the expression levels of AQP4 and AQP9 in the serum of patients with acute cerebral infarction were positively correlated with NIHSS score(r=0.488,0.609;P<0.05).Compared with the mild deficit group,the levels of serum AQP4 and AQP9 in the moderate deficit group were increased;compared with the moderate deficit group,the levels of serum AQP4 and AQP9 in the severe deficit group were increased(F=34.454,44.728;P<0.05).Multivariate Logistic regression analysis showed that blood uric acid,anticardiolipin antibodies,hs-CRP,BNP,Hcy,AQP4,and AQP9 were risk factors for acute cerebral infarction(OR=1.748,1.894,1.928,3.164,2.593,2.163,1.975;P<0.05).Conclusion The expression levels of AQP4 and AQP9 in the serum of patients with acute cerebral infarction are elevated and closely related to the severity of brain injury.
